Lighttpd Adalah: Fungsi, Keunggulan, Instalasi Lengkap
Pernahkah kamu mendengar tentang Lighttpd? Mungkin terdengar asing, tapi sebenarnya, ini adalah salah satu web server yang cukup populer di kalangan pengembang web, terutama karena efisiensinya. Dalam artikel ini, kita akan membahas apa itu Lighttpd, bagaimana cara kerjanya, keunggulannya, serta bagaimana cara menginstalnya di VPS. Yuk, simak penjelasan lengkapnya!
Contents
Definisi Lighttpd
Lighttpd adalah perangkat lunak web server sumber terbuka (open-source) yang dirancang khusus untuk mengoptimalkan penggunaan sumber daya, seperti CPU dan RAM, dalam lingkungan dengan keterbatasan sumber daya.
Sejak pertama kali dirilis pada tahun 2003 oleh Jan Kneschke, seorang pengembang perangkat lunak asal Jerman, Lighttpd telah berkembang menjadi pilihan favorit bagi banyak pengembang dan penyedia hosting.
Hal ini dikarenakan Lighttpd beroperasi dengan kecepatan tinggi karena arsitekturnya berbasis peristiwa (event-driven architecture). Dengan pendekatan ini, server dapat menangani banyak koneksi sekaligus tanpa membebani memori dan CPU.
Jadi, meski server kamu banyak menerima pengunjung , kinerja tetap terjaga. Performa ini menjadikan Lighttpd cocok digunakan di berbagai lingkungan seperti server Linux, Windows, hingga instant cloud atau aplikasi yang terkontainerisasi.
Selain itu, fitur canggih seperti FastCGI, SCGI, Auth, Output-Compression, dan URL-Rewriting semakin memperkuat kemampuannya dalam memberikan performa yang optimal.
Ini semua menjadikan Lighttpd sebagai pilihan yang lebih efisien dibandingkan dengan server lain seperti Apache, Nginx, IIS, atau LiteSpeed.
Perbandingan Lighttpd dengan Web Server Lain
Berbeda dengan web server lain, seperti Apache atau NGINX, Lighttpd menawarkan solusi yang lebih ringan dan efisien dalam menangani permintaan dari pengguna, tanpa mengorbankan performa.
Lighttpd bekerja dengan cara yang efisien untuk menangani beban lalu lintas web yang tinggi, tanpa membebani sistem.
Sementara Apache dikenal karena kemampuannya dalam kustomisasi dan memiliki banyak modul, Lighttpd lebih mengutamakan efisiensi.
Di sisi lain, NGINX dikenal sebagai web server yang sangat stabil, tetapi Lighttpd tetap unggul dalam penggunaan sumber daya yang lebih sedikit.
Meskipun lebih jarang mendapatkan pembaruan seperti NGINX, Lighttpd tetap menjadi pilihan yang sangat baik, terutama untuk situs dengan lalu lintas tinggi yang memerlukan pengelolaan sumber daya secara efisien.
Baca Juga: Apache vs Nginx: Melihat Perbedaannya Secara Mendalam
Cara Kerja Lighttpd
Seperti yang sudah disebutkan sebelumnya bahwa cara kerja Lighttpd sangat bergantung pada arsitektur berbasis peristiwa (event-driven architecture). Yuk, kita bahas lebih lanjut tentang bagaimana Lighttpd bekerja!
- Arsitektur Event-Driven
Lighttpd hanya mengalokasikan sumber daya untuk menangani peristiwa tertentu, seperti permintaan HTTP. Hal ini memungkinkan server mengelola banyak koneksi secara paralel dengan memori minimal, lebih hemat dibandingkan server lain seperti Apache. - Modular dan Fleksibel
Dengan struktur modular, Lighttpd memungkinkan penambahan atau konfigurasi modul seperti FastCGI dan URL rewriting, meningkatkan pengelolaan konten dinamis dan statis tanpa beban ekstra. - Penanganan Koneksi Paralel
Lighttpd unggul dalam menangani banyak koneksi bersamaan tanpa mempengaruhi kinerja, bahkan di bawah beban lalu lintas tinggi. - Keamanan Ketat
Dilengkapi dengan fitur seperti SSL/TLS dan kontrol akses berbasis IP, Lighttpd menjaga server dan data tetap aman. - Efisiensi Sumber Daya
Dengan pengelolaan koneksi yang efisien, Lighttpd meminimalkan penggunaan CPU dan memori, cocok untuk situs dengan lalu lintas tinggi.
Baca Juga: 11 Alasan Memilih LiteSpeed Web Server untuk Website Optimal
Fungsi Lighttpd dalam Web Hosting
Pada dasarnya, Lighttpd berfungsi untuk melayani permintaan HTTP dari klien dan menyajikan konten yang diminta. Entah itu file HTML statis, gambar, atau konten dinamis yang dihasilkan oleh skrip, semua dapat dilayani dengan efisien.
Dalam dunia web hosting, Lighttpd memegang peranan penting karena kecepatan dan efisiensinya. Server ini sangat cocok untuk melayani situs web statis atau berkas media, menjadikannya pilihan populer untuk situs dengan lalu lintas tinggi dan content delivery network (CDN).
Selain itu, Lighttpd mendukung antarmuka FastCGI, SCGI, dan CGI untuk program eksternal, memungkinkan aplikasi web yang ditulis dalam bahasa pemrograman apa pun untuk dilayani oleh Lighttpd. Dukungan protokol kriptografi SSL/TLS juga memastikan koneksi antara server dan klien tetap aman.
Arsitektur modular Lighttpd memungkinkan kustomisasi yang sangat fleksibel, di mana berbagai modul bisa diaktifkan atau dinonaktifkan sesuai kebutuhan.
Dengan cara ini, para administrator web dapat menyesuaikan server dengan spesifikasi dan kebutuhan unik mereka.
Dalam konteks web hosting, peran Lighttpd sangat penting dalam menyediakan solusi server web yang ringan dan berkinerja tinggi, yang bisa menangani beban lalu lintas tinggi sambil tetap hemat dalam penggunaan sumber daya.
Baca Juga: Resource VPS untuk Kinerja Optimal: RAM, CPU, Disk Space!
Fitur Utama Lighttpd
- Dukungan FastCGI, SCGI, dan CGI untuk aplikasi web.
- Koneksi yang aman menggunakan SSL/TLS.
- Virtual hosting yang fleksibel, baik berdasarkan IP maupun nama.
- Load balancing untuk meningkatkan performa dan keandalan.
- Penulisan ulang URL dan pengalihan permanen untuk struktur URL yang lebih bersih.
Banyak perusahaan besar dan situs web yang sudah memanfaatkan keunggulan Lighttpd ini. Beberapa pengguna terkenal Lighttpd di antaranya YouTube, Wikipedia, Meebo, Xkcd, dan TTNET.
Keunggulan dan Kekurangan Lighttpd
Seperti semua perangkat lunak, Lighttpd juga memiliki keunggulan dan kekurangan. Berikut beberapa hal yang perlu kamu ketahui:
Keunggulan:
- Performa tinggi dengan penggunaan memori yang rendah berkat arsitektur berbasis peristiwa.
- Mudah disesuaikan berkat desain modularnya.
- Mendukung berbagai fitur canggih seperti FastCGI, SSL/TLS, dan load balancing.
- Cocok untuk situs dengan konten statis atau media yang membutuhkan kecepatan tinggi.
Kekurangan:
- Meskipun fitur-fitur canggih ada, dokumentasi Lighttpd tidak selengkap web server lain seperti Apache atau NGINX.
- Kurang populer dibandingkan dengan NGINX atau Apache, sehingga sumber daya dan dukungan komunitas lebih terbatas.
Baca Juga: Alasan Webuzo adalah Control Panel yang Tepat untuk VPS
Cara Instal Lighttpd di VPS
Menginstal Lighttpd di VPS cukup mudah dan bisa dilakukan dalam beberapa langkah sederhana. Berikut ini adalah panduan instalasi untuk sistem berbasis Debian (seperti Ubuntu):
- Perbarui sistem
Sebelum menginstal Lighttpd, pastikan sistem kamu terbarui agar menggunakan versi terbaru dari paket-paket yang ada. Jalankan perintah berikut:sudo apt-get update
Ini akan memperbarui daftar repositori dan memastikan sistem kamu siap untuk menginstal paket terbaru. - Instal Lighttpd
Setelah sistem diperbarui, kamu bisa langsung menginstal Lighttpd menggunakan perintah ini:sudo apt-get install lighttpd
Proses ini akan mengunduh dan menginstal Lighttpd beserta semua dependensinya. - Verifikasi instalasi
Setelah instalasi selesai, pastikan Lighttpd berjalan dengan baik dengan memeriksa status layanan menggunakan perintah:sudo service lighttpd status
Jika semuanya berjalan dengan lancar, statusnya akan menunjukkan bahwa layanan Lighttpd aktif. - Konfigurasi dasar
Lighttpd memiliki file konfigurasi utama yang terletak di/etc/lighttpd/lighttpd.conf
. Di sini, kamu dapat menyesuaikan pengaturan server sesuai dengan kebutuhanmu, seperti mengubah direktori root, port server, atau mengaktifkan modul-modul tambahan. - Restart layanan
Setelah melakukan perubahan pada file konfigurasi, kamu perlu merestart layanan Lighttpd agar konfigurasi baru diterapkan. Gunakan perintah berikut:sudo service lighttpd restart
Dengan ini, konfigurasi yang sudah diubah akan segera diterapkan dan server siap digunakan.
Baca Juga: Perbedaan Perintah YUM dan APT, Begini Fungsinya di Linux!
Kesimpulan
Lighttpd adalah pilihan web server yang sangat efisien dan ringan, ideal untuk situs dengan banyak pengunjung atau situs yang membutuhkan kecepatan tinggi dengan sumber daya terbatas.
Dengan arsitektur berbasis peristiwa dan desain modular, Lighttpd menawarkan fleksibilitas dan kinerja yang luar biasa. Meskipun mungkin bukan pilihan utama untuk semua jenis situs web, bagi kamu yang mencari solusi web server yang efisien, Lighttpd bisa jadi pilihan yang tepat.
Jika kamu tertarik untuk menggunakan Lighttpd dan membutuhkan hosting yang bisa mendukungnya, layanan VPS Murah dari IDwebhost! bisa menjadi pilihan terbaik. Dengan berbagai fitur unggulan dan harga yang terjangkau, VPS dari IDwebhost siap memberikan performa maksimal untuk situs webmu!
Member since 7 Aug 2024